Layering is what separates a set table from a styled table. It's the difference between crockery on a cloth and a table that has been genuinely composed - where each element relates to the others in scale, height and texture.

This guide covers how to build a table setting in layers from the cloth up: chargers, dinner plates, side plates, glassware at varying heights, linen, name cards, flowers and decorative objects. How to create visual interest without clutter. How to use antique and vintage pieces alongside contemporary ones. How to know when to stop.
